No entrare en mucho detalle y profundidad acerca del codigo y como funciona solo dire que la key sirve para que el hash de salida sea muy diferente aun teniendo la misma entrada pero con una key diferente.

|
|||
| Tema destacado: ¿Eres nuevo? ¿Tienes dudas acerca del funcionamiento de la comunidad? Lee las Reglas Generales |
|
|||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
|